What is SQL Backup and FTP?
SQL Backup and FTP is a popular software tool designed to backup and transfer SQL Server databases using FTP (File Transfer Protocol). The software automates the backup process, allowing users to schedule backups, compress and encrypt database files, and transfer them to a remote FTP server or cloud storage. This ensures that database administrators can rest assured that their critical data is safe and can be easily restored in case of a disaster. license key sqlbackupandftp full

SQLBackupAndFTP is a popular backup software designed to automate database backups for Microsoft SQL Server, MySQL, PostgreSQL, Azure SQL, and Amazon RDS. It simplifies the process of creating database backups, compressing them, encrypting them, and uploading them to various cloud storage destinations or local network folders. For users managing production databases or multiple servers, understanding the licensing model of SQLBackupAndFTP is crucial for ensuring continuous, legal, and feature-complete operations.
The software operates on a freemium model. The free version allows users to back up a limited number of databases and schedule basic backup jobs. However, businesses and advanced users typically require the expanded capabilities found in the paid tiers, such as the Professional or Enterprise editions. Accessing these advanced features requires a valid, full license key. A full license key is a unique alphanumeric string provided by the software developer, Pranas.NET, upon purchasing a subscription or a lifetime license.
Acquiring a legitimate full license key unlocks several critical capabilities necessary for enterprise-grade database management. First, it removes the restrictions on the number of databases you can back up, allowing administrators to secure an entire server environment with a single installation. Second, paid licenses unlock advanced backup destinations. While the free version supports basic destinations, a full license enables seamless integration with professional cloud storage providers like Amazon S3, Microsoft Azure, Google Cloud Storage, and secure FTP servers (SFTP/FTPS).
Security and automation are also heavily tied to the license tier. A full license enables AES 256-bit encryption, ensuring that sensitive database backups remain protected against unauthorized access during transit and while at rest in the cloud. Furthermore, it unlocks transaction log backups and differential backups. These are essential for implementing a professional backup strategy that minimizes data loss (Recovery Point Objective) and reduces backup windows and storage consumption.
It is important to address the risks associated with seeking "full license keys" through unauthorized means, such as "cracks," keygens, or public sharing sites. Using pirated license keys or modified executables poses severe security risks to an organization. Database backups contain highly sensitive corporate and user data. Cracked software frequently acts as a Trojan horse for malware, ransomware, or backdoors that can expose your entire network to cyberattacks. Additionally, unauthorized keys bypass the official update channels, leaving the backup software vulnerable to unpatched security flaws and incompatible with newer operating system or database versions.
